How do you take away Elon Musk, the wealthiest particular person on Earth and the chief of SpaceX, from SpaceX? Seems, solely Musk holds that energy.
The aerospace producer and house transport firm revealed this to traders at a latest assembly.
How does Elon Musk keep his super-voting rights?
The paperwork state that Musk maintains management via a dual-class share construction that provides him super-voting rights. Below this settlement, Musk “can solely be faraway from our board or these positions by a vote of Class B shareholders,” a category of shares he largely controls.
Consequently, he can successfully retain his place so long as he continues to carry a good portion of the Class B frequent inventory for an prolonged interval.
What are dual-class shares
The dialogue comes within the wake of Area X’s discussions to go public. Twin class share buildings are frequent amongst founder-led tech firms, permitting founders and early traders to retain higher management than public shareholders, whereas boards usually maintain the formal authority to take away a CEO.
Nevertheless, in Musk’s case, company governance specialists say the provisions go additional. After reviewing the corporate’s founding and authorized paperwork, specialists famous that the construction successfully offers Musk “a veto over any try to take away him.”
They added that the extent of management Musk wields goes past the norm, because it straight ties his elimination to his personal voting energy.
Story continues under this advert
Area X has warned potential traders about their restricted means to affect company issues or take part within the elections of administrators.
